Key Responsibilities
- Develop and execute a comprehensive global affiliate strategy aligned with overall company growth and revenue objectives.
- Own performance goals for the affiliates function and their adherence to targets performance metrics.
- Manage the affiliate platform, including tracking, reporting, and commission payments.
- Design and implement AI-driven automation frameworks in the affiliate space.
- Strategically curate a high-impact B2B partner ecosystem.
- Optimize our affiliate commission structure to maximize ROAS and LTV.
- Maintain strong, ongoing relationships with top-performing affiliates through proactive communication, support, and appreciation.
- Work with the content and design teams to ensure affiliates have up-to-date and high-converting marketing materials (banners, links, email templates, etc.).
- Ensure all affiliate activities are in compliance with brand guidelines and relevant legal and regulatory requirements.
What you bring
- Several years of experience managing an affiliate program within a B2B or SaaS environment.
- Proven track record of significantly growing affiliate-generated revenue in a global/multi language environment.
- Deep understanding of affiliate tracking technology, reporting, and analytics.
- Excellent negotiation, communication, and interpersonal skills.
- Familiar with Impact.com.
